Bean, Bush - Tongue of Fire

Not only does the Tongue of Fire Bush Bean have one of the best names for a vegetable, this Italian heirloom bean produces beautiful, flavorful wide cranberry streaked pods. Originally collected in Tierra del Fuego on the tip of South America, it produces 6"-7" long pods on a compact plant. Eat it young as a green bean, shell it when it matures, or let it dry and cook the large beans as you would kidney beans.

SEED PLANTING TIPS

  • Botanical name: Phaseolus vulgaris
  • Depth to plant seeds: 1" deep
  • Spacing between plants: 4" apart
  • Spacing between rows: 18"-24" apart
  • Days to germinate (sprout): 5-10 days
  • Germination soil temps: 70F-85F
  • Soil needs: 6.0-7.0 pH
  • Sun needs: Full sun
  • Frost hardy: No
  • Planting season: Spring, summer, fall
  • # of plants per sq. ft.: Appx. 4 plants per sq. ft.
  • Days to maturity: 55-90 days

Good companion plants: Cucumber, Pea, Rosemary, Thyme, Tomato
